What is a sleep schedule reset, exactly?
A sleep schedule reset is a planned shift in sleep timing using consistent wake time, light exposure, and evening cues.
Your body keeps time with a circadian system that runs close to 24 hours. The suprachiasmatic nucleus in the hypothalamus receives light information from the eyes and helps time melatonin, body temperature, alertness, and sleep pressure. The American Academy of Sleep Medicine recommends at least 7 hours of sleep for most adults, but the clock that makes those 7 hours feel possible is trained by repetition.
A reset is not the same as one early night. If you usually fall asleep at 1:00 a.m. and decide to sleep at 10:30 p.m. tonight, your body may treat the new bedtime as a long, quiet waiting room. In practice, many people do better by moving bedtime 15 to 30 minutes earlier every 2 or 3 nights while keeping wake time fixed. That gives the clock a clear signal without asking it to jump three time zones.
The Centers for Disease Control and Prevention has reported that about 1 in 3 U.S. adults sleep less than 7 hours on a typical night. Some of that is work, caregiving, pain, and noise. Some of it is timing. A sleep schedule reset addresses the timing part plainly: wake at the same hour, get light early, reduce light late, and repeat a short cue until the body recognizes the sequence.

How do you set up the 7-night reset?
Set the reset around one fixed wake time, then build a short evening sequence that starts 60 minutes before bed.
Start with the morning, not the night. Choose a wake time you can hold for 7 days. The National Sleep Foundation often describes regularity as a core sleep hygiene behavior, and the reason is practical: wake time sets the pressure for the next night. If you sleep in for 2 hours after a bad night, you may reduce sleep pressure when you need it most.
Then set the light rules. Within 30 to 60 minutes of waking, get outdoor light if possible. On a cloudy day, outdoor light is still often brighter than indoor light; common indoor lighting may be 100 to 500 lux, while overcast daylight can reach several thousand lux. At night, reverse the signal. Dim overhead lights 60 minutes before your target sleep time.
Use this sequence for 7 nights:
- Wake at the same time, within a 30-minute window.
- Get morning light for 5 to 20 minutes, depending on weather and schedule.
- Stop caffeine 8 to 10 hours before bedtime if you’re sensitive.
- Dim lights 60 minutes before bed.
- Play the 3-minute Dream-Self cue once.
- Use masking sound only if the room needs it.
- Record lights-out time and wake time in the morning.
The caffeine number is not moral advice; it is pharmacokinetics. Caffeine’s half-life is often cited around 5 hours, with wide individual variation. Dr. Andrew Huberman and many sleep clinicians suggest cutting it earlier than most people expect because even reduced caffeine can affect sleep depth in sensitive sleepers.

What should the audio cue sound like?
The cue should sound close, steady, low in volume, and free of sharp transients.
For sleep, the recording has two jobs: intelligibility and softness. You should hear the words without leaning in, but the voice should not behave like a podcast host trying to keep you engaged. Aim for a playback level lower than normal conversation. The World Health Organization has used 40 dB as a night-noise guideline for protecting sleep in community settings, and while a phone speaker isn’t a calibrated meter, the principle holds: quieter than you think.

What if your room is noisy, your partner is awake, or your mind is loud?
Use the cue as the fixed marker, then adjust the sound bed and environment around the specific obstacle.
Noise is not one problem. It can be steady, intermittent, high, low, close, or distant. A refrigerator hum is different from a scooter passing under the window. In sleep research, intermittent noise is often more disruptive than continuous sound because the brain reacts to change. A 2012 World Health Organization review on environmental noise noted that night noise can affect sleep through awakenings, body movement, and cardiovascular activation.
For a noisy room, masking helps when it raises the acoustic floor gently. Press play below on the white noise generator + guide and listen for the difference between a sharp room and a steady room. If white noise feels too hissy, try pink or brown noise. Brown noise isn’t deeper sleep. It’s deeper sound: more low-frequency acoustic energy, less top-end spray. Some nervous systems prefer it. For a loud mind, don’t add more instructions. Try a short written offload 30 minutes before the cue: three unfinished tasks, one next action for each, then close the notebook. In a small 2018 study in the Journal of Experimental Psychology, writing a to-do list before bed helped participants fall asleep faster than writing about completed tasks. The sample was modest, so treat it as a useful clue, not a law.

If anxiety, tinnitus, apnea symptoms, or chronic insomnia are part of the pattern, bring in professional help. A cue can support a routine. It should not be asked to diagnose the night.
How do you know the reset is working?
You know it is working when wake time stabilizes first, then sleep onset becomes less effortful over several nights.
Do not judge the reset by Night 1. Circadian shifts are slow. Jet lag research often uses the rough idea of about 1 day per time zone crossed, though light timing can change that. For a home sleep schedule reset, a 7-night window is a fair minimum, and 14 nights gives a clearer read if your starting point is irregular.
Track only two or three numbers. Too much data at bedtime can make sleep feel like a test. Write down lights-out time, estimated sleep onset if you know it, and final wake time. If you use a wearable, remember that consumer devices estimate sleep stages from movement and heart rate. They can show trends, but polysomnography remains the clinical standard.

If nothing changes after 14 nights, adjust the anchors, not the hope. Move the target bedtime later for a week, increase morning light, reduce evening light more strongly, or review caffeine and alcohol timing. Alcohol may make sleep onset easier but tends to fragment the second half of the night; sleep labs have shown this pattern for decades.

Then reduce light. If you have only bright overheads, use one lamp in the corner. If you need a screen, lower brightness and stop using it for anything that asks for response: messages, comments, shopping, work. In laboratory studies, evening light has been shown to suppress melatonin and delay circadian timing; a well-known 2015 paper in PNAS found that evening e-reader use delayed melatonin onset compared with print reading.
